.login-page{font-size:14px;letter-spacing:0;margin-top:35px}.login-page input{width:100%;margin-bottom:20px}.login-page input[type=submit]{font-size:16px;letter-spacing:1.28px}.login-page #accepts_marketing_checkbox input{display:inline-block;width:auto;margin-right:5px}.login-page .form-reactivate{padding-bottom:10px;text-align:center;letter-spacing:0;font-style:14px}.login-page .form-reactivate .open-reactivate,.login-page #RecoverPasswordForm input[type=submit]{font-size:16px;letter-spacing:1.28px}.modal-form{width:500px;padding:35px 20px 20px;height:auto;bottom:auto;right:auto;top:50%;left:50%;transform:translate3d(-50%,-50%,0);-webkit-transform:translate3d(-50%,-50%,0);position:fixed;z-index:9999;background:var(--white-color);display:none}@media only screen and (max-width:500px){.modal-form{width:100%}}.modal-form.active{display:block}.modal-overlay.active{position:fixed;top:0;left:0;right:0;bottom:0;width:100%;height:100%;background:var(--black-color);z-index:999;opacity:.25}.form-message,.note{padding:8px;margin:0 0 27.5px;border:1px solid var(--color-border-form)}.form-message--success{border:1px solid var(--succes-color);background-color:var(--form-message-bg-color);color:var(--succes-color)!important;display:block;width:100%}.form-message--error{color:var(--error-color);border:1px solid var(--error2-color);background-color:var(--form-message-bg-color);padding:1rem 1.3rem;text-align:left;width:100%}.form-message--error li{list-style-type:disc;list-style-position:inside}.form-message--error .form-message__title{font-size:1.2em}.form-message--error .form-message__link{display:inline-block;text-decoration:underline;-webkit-text-decoration-skip:ink;text-decoration-skip-ink:auto;color:var(--error-color)}.form-message--error .form-message__link:focus{text-decoration:none;color:var(--error-color)}.form-message--error .form-message__link:hover{text-decoration:none;color:var(--error-color)}.form-message--error a{display:inline-block;text-decoration:underline;-webkit-text-decoration-skip:ink;text-decoration-skip-ink:auto;color:var(--error-color)}.form-message--error a:focus{text-decoration:none;color:var(--error-color)}.form-message--error a:hover{text-decoration:none;color:var(--error-color)}.password-form-message{max-width:500px;margin-left:auto;margin-right:auto}@media only screen and (min-width:750px){.form-message,.note{padding:10px}}svg.icon:not(.icon--full-color) .icon-error__symbol,symbol.icon:not(.icon--full-color) .icon-error__symbol{fill:var(--white-color)}.input-error-message{display:flex;line-height:1.3;color:var(--color-body-text);font-size:12.25px;margin-bottom:11.66667px}.input-error-message .icon{width:1em;height:1em;margin-right:8px}@media only screen and (max-width:749px){.input-error-message{margin-bottom:19.44444px}}#RecoverHeading{font-size:17.5px}#reactivate{font-size:14px;letter-spacing:0}#reactivate .close-modal{cursor:pointer}#reactivate h3{font-weight:700;letter-spacing:0;font-size:22.75px;font-family:Helvetica,Helvetica Neue,Arial,Lucida Grande,sans-serif}#reactivate input{font-size:16px;padding:8px 18px;font-weight:400;font-family:Helvetica}@media only screen and (max-width:500px){.reactivate-form{display:flex;flex-wrap:wrap}}
/*# sourceMappingURL=/cdn/shop/t/53/assets/login.css.map */
